The U.S. Geological Survey, in collaboration with the Cooperative Ecosystem Studies Unit, Southern Appalachian CESU, is providing a grant for collaborative research on artificial beach nourishment activities. This grant aims to produce valuable insights through field and laboratory studies to enhance coastal infrastructure and habitat resilience against future storms and sea-level rise. Application deadline is on Apr 24, 2015.

Additional Information on Eligibility: | This financial assistance opportunity is being issued under a Cooperative Ecosystem Studies Unit (CESU) Program. CESU�s are partnerships that provide research, technical assistance, and education. Eligible recipients must be a participating partner of the Southern Appalachian Cooperative Ecosystems Studies Unit (CESU) Program. |

Description: | The U.S. Geological Survey is offering a funding opportunity to a CESU partner to provide collaborative research for field and laboratory studies to map and study artificial beach nourishment activities. The project will produce actionable information for understanding and improving the resilience of coastal infrastructure and habitat to future storms and sea-level rise. |
